Example 1: https://builds.apache.org/job/beam_PreCommit_MavenVerify/3934/org.apache.beam$beam-examples-java/console

Here it looks like we need to retry listing files, at least a little bit, if none are found. They did show up:

{code}
gsutil ls gs://temp-storage-for-end-to-end-tests/WordCountIT-2016-10-13-12-37-02-467/output/results\*
gs://temp-storage-for-end-to-end-tests/WordCountIT-2016-10-13-12-37-02-467/output/results-00000-of-00003
gs://temp-storage-for-end-to-end-tests/WordCountIT-2016-10-13-12-37-02-467/output/results-00001-of-00003
gs://temp-storage-for-end-to-end-tests/WordCountIT-2016-10-13-12-37-02-467/output/results-00002-of-00003
{code}
